Burton Holmes (1870-1958) was an intrepid American explorer, crisscrossing the globe photographing and filming foreign cultures, and coining the term “travelogue.” He lectured widely, catering to the armchair traveler, and eventually Hollywood came knocking. In this travel short, Holmes spotlights the Ainu, indigenous people of Japan and Russia.
